Statutory Authority : Definition Statutory Authority is a body which has received powers to do something as conferred by law. If someone try to obstruct the exercise of power of this Statutory Authority there is an implied threat of legal action involved. …

Statutory Authority. Minnesota Statutes 2020, 3.971 through 3.979, give the Legislative Auditor broad authority to audit state agencies, evaluate public programs, and investigate alleged misuse of public money.
